Coastal houses in El Segundo often face electrical issues caused by salt air, moisture, and coastal humidity. These environmental factors can speed up corrosion, wear down wiring, and affect the reliability of outdoor electrical components.

Common electrical issues include:

  • Corrosion on Panels and Breakers: Salt exposure leads to rust and poor electrical contact.
  • Deteriorated Wiring Insulation: Moisture and salt can weaken insulation, increasing the risk of shorts.
  • Flickering Lights or Power Fluctuations: Corroded connections and outdoor wiring degrade performance over time.
  • GFCI Outlet Failures: High humidity can cause outdoor safety outlets to trip or malfunction prematurely.
  • Reduced Lifespan of Fixtures: Outdoor lights and hardware wear faster without weather-rated protection.
  • Moisture Intrusion in Conduits: Salt-laden air and condensation can enter junction boxes, leading to corrosion or electrical faults.

Protecting your home’s electronics from power surges starts with installing layered surge protection and maintaining a stable electrical system. Sudden voltage spikes from storms, grid fluctuations, or large appliances can cause serious damage to sensitive devices.

Effective protection methods include:

  • Whole-Home Surge Protection: Installed at the main electrical panel to block large voltage spikes from entering the home.
  • Point-of-Use Surge Protectors: Power strips with built-in surge suppression for computers, TVs, and entertainment systems.
  • Dedicated Circuits for Major Appliances: Prevents heavy equipment like HVAC units from causing internal surges.
  • Regular Electrical Inspections: Detects loose connections or faulty wiring that can trigger small, repeated surges.
  • Unplugging Devices During Storms: Adds an extra layer of safety during severe weather or outages.
  • Smart Energy Monitoring Systems: Track voltage fluctuations and alert you to irregular power patterns before damage occurs.

Yes, sea air can significantly affect outdoor wiring and lighting in El Segundo. The salty moisture in the coastal atmosphere accelerates corrosion, weakens electrical connections, and shortens the lifespan of fixtures and components.

Common effects and preventive steps include:

  • Corrosion on Metal Parts: Salt deposits cause rust and oxidation on wiring, fixtures, and hardware.
  • Deterioration of Wiring Insulation: Moisture and salt can crack or break down insulation over time.
  • Reduced Lighting Performance: Corroded sockets and connectors can cause flickering or dim lights.
  • Premature Fixture Failure: Non-weatherproof lighting deteriorates faster in salty, humid conditions.
  • Use of Marine-Grade Materials: Stainless steel, brass, and coated metals resist corrosion in coastal environments.
  • Routine Cleaning & Maintenance: Regular washing and inspection help remove salt buildup and prevent long-term damage.

When buying a generator or backup power system, it’s important to choose one that fits your home’s energy needs, budget, and safety requirements. The right system will provide reliable power during outages and integrate smoothly with your existing electrical setup.

Key factors to look for:

  • Power Capacity: Choose a generator that can handle your essential circuits—HVAC, refrigeration, lighting, and medical devices.
  • Fuel Type: Options include natural gas, propane, diesel, or solar battery systems, each with different efficiency and maintenance needs.
  • Automatic Transfer Switch: Enables seamless switching between utility and backup power.
  • Location & Ventilation: Must meet clearance and airflow requirements for safe operation.
  • Maintenance & Service Access: Pick a model with easy access for regular servicing and testing.
  • Permits & Local Codes: Confirm installation complies with city and California safety standards.
  • Long-Term Efficiency: Consider inverter generators or battery-based systems for quieter, cleaner, and more efficient backup power.

Rewiring part of a home during a remodel involves planning, permitting, and safe installation to update circuits and meet current electrical codes. This process improves performance, supports modern appliances, and enhances overall safety.

The main steps include:

  • Initial Assessment: A licensed electrician inspects existing wiring to determine what needs replacement or upgrading.
  • Load Calculation & Planning: Determines circuit capacity and layout for new rooms, lighting, or appliances.
  • Permitting & Code Compliance: Electrical work must be approved and inspected by the local building department.
  • Removing Old Wiring: Outdated or damaged wiring is safely disconnected and cleared.
  • Installing New Circuits & Outlets: Modern grounded wiring, switches, and outlets are added to support new layouts.
  • Testing & Inspection: Every circuit is tested for safety and functionality before final approval.
